File No. 704.6712/9.

The Secretary of State ad interim to the Chargé d’Affaires of Turkey.

No. 25.]

Sir: I have the honor to enclose herewith a copy of a despatch of the 1st instant from the American Consul at Aguascalientes reporting that at the request of the firm of S. Bujdud Hermano and Jalife, Ottoman subjects, he has obtained the release of ninety-four bales of cotton which had been sequestered by the Mexican Government.

I should be glad to be informed whether the Embassy has any advices concerning the report contained in the despatch as to the designation of the German Consul at San Luis Potosí to care for Ottoman interests.

Accept [etc.]

Robert Lansing.
